.LOCKER Top-Level Domain

A generic top-level domain (gTLD) intended for businesses and individuals related to storage, security, or personal safekeeping services.

Type: gTLD
Introduced: 2016
WHOIS Server: whois.nic.locker
Average Pricing: Not available
Restrictions: None

Fun Facts

The .LOCKER domain was initially applied for by Dish DBS Corporation, a subsidiary of DISH Network, a major satellite television provider in the United States.
